コード例 #5
0
        private async void UploadSingleFile(Uri uri, StorageFile file)
        {
            if (file == null)
            {
                rootPage.NotifyUser("No file selected.", NotifyType.ErrorMessage);
                return;
            }

            BasicProperties properties = await file.GetBasicPropertiesAsync();
            if (properties.Size > maxUploadFileSize)
            {
                rootPage.NotifyUser(String.Format(CultureInfo.CurrentCulture, 
                    "Selected file exceeds max. upload file size ({0} MB).", maxUploadFileSize / (1024 * 1024)),
                    NotifyType.ErrorMessage);
                return;
            }

            BackgroundUploader uploader = new BackgroundUploader();
            uploader.SetRequestHeader("Filename", file.Name);

            UploadOperation upload = uploader.CreateUpload(uri, file);
            Log(String.Format(CultureInfo.CurrentCulture, "Uploading {0} to {1}, {2}", file.Name, uri.AbsoluteUri, 
                upload.Guid));

            // Attach progress and completion handlers.
            await HandleUploadAsync(upload, true);
        }

コード例 #10
0
        private async void OnGetUploadLinkCompleted(LiveOperationResult result)
        {
            if (this.Status == OperationStatus.Cancelled)
            {
                base.OnCancel();
                return;
            }

            if (result.Error != null || result.IsCancelled)
            {
                this.OnOperationCompleted(result);
                return;
            }

            var uploadUrl = new Uri(result.RawResult, UriKind.Absolute);

            // NOTE: the GetUploadLinkOperation will return a uri with the overwite, suppress_response_codes,
            // and suppress_redirect query parameters set.
            Debug.Assert(uploadUrl.Query != null);
            Debug.Assert(uploadUrl.Query.Contains(QueryParameters.Overwrite));
            Debug.Assert(uploadUrl.Query.Contains(QueryParameters.SuppressRedirects));
            Debug.Assert(uploadUrl.Query.Contains(QueryParameters.SuppressResponseCodes));

            var uploader = new BT.BackgroundUploader();
            uploader.Group = LiveConnectClient.LiveSDKUploadGroup;
            if (this.LiveClient.Session != null)
            {
                uploader.SetRequestHeader(
                    ApiOperation.AuthorizationHeader,
                    AuthConstants.BearerTokenType + " " + this.LiveClient.Session.AccessToken);
            }
            uploader.SetRequestHeader(ApiOperation.LibraryHeader, Platform.GetLibraryHeaderValue());
            uploader.Method = HttpMethods.Put;

            this.uploadOpCts = new CancellationTokenSource();
            Exception webError = null;

            LiveOperationResult opResult = null;
            try
            {
                if (this.InputStream != null)
                {
                    this.uploadOp = await uploader.CreateUploadFromStreamAsync(uploadUrl, this.InputStream);
                }
                else
                {
                    this.uploadOp = uploader.CreateUpload(uploadUrl, this.InputFile);
                }

                var progressHandler = new Progress<BT.UploadOperation>(this.OnUploadProgress);

                this.uploadOp = await this.uploadOp.StartAsync().AsTask(this.uploadOpCts.Token, progressHandler);
            }
            catch (TaskCanceledException exception)
            {
                opResult = new LiveOperationResult(exception, true);
            }
            catch (Exception exp)
            {
                // This might be an server error. We will read the response to determine the error message.
                webError = exp;
            }

            if (opResult == null)
            {
                try
                {
                    IInputStream responseStream = this.uploadOp.GetResultStreamAt(0);
                    if (responseStream == null)
                    {
                        var error = new LiveConnectException(
                            ApiOperation.ApiClientErrorCode,
                            ResourceHelper.GetString("ConnectionError"));
                        opResult = new LiveOperationResult(error, false);
                    }
                    else
                    {
                        var reader = new DataReader(responseStream);
                        uint length = await reader.LoadAsync(MaxUploadResponseLength);
                        opResult = ApiOperation.CreateOperationResultFrom(reader.ReadString(length), ApiMethod.Upload);

                        if (webError != null && opResult.Error != null && !(opResult.Error is LiveConnectException))
                        {
                            // If the error did not come from the api service,
                            // we'll just return the error thrown by the uploader.
                            opResult = new LiveOperationResult(webError, false);
                        }
                    }
                }
                catch (COMException exp)
                {
                    opResult = new LiveOperationResult(exp, false);
                }
                catch (FileNotFoundException exp)
                {
                    opResult = new LiveOperationResult(exp, false);
                }
            }

            this.OnOperationCompleted(opResult);
        }
